The top navigation panel will have the following options:

  • Go Back: this option will lead you either to the Job posting page or to the Job ads list depending on the status of the job. If it is Draft, for example, clicking on this button will ask you if you want to save it as a draft or remove it. Afterwards you will see Job posting page.

  • Job status: Draft, Live: Open for applicants, Stop receiving applicants, Completed (read more about it here).

  • Go Live/Submit changes/Update: Go Live will publish the job to the selected sourcing channels and make your job available for the applicants. Submit changes or Update button appears after you make some changes to the job, but have not yet activated them. So only after you click this button, the changes become available for the applicants.

  • Preview icon: click on this icon to see how the job ad will look like for applications. Preview the job ad before publishing it.

  • Share: select and share your job to the well-known social media channels.

  • More actions "...": this option will open additional actions which you might perform to the job, like Delete, Duplicate etc. NOTE: depending on Job status (Live, Unpublished, Completed or Draft) there will different actions which can be performed to the job.

NOTE: the navigation panel is available on all the pages of your job (Job Details, Job Listing Editor, Job Process, Sourcing channels), so you can perform the actions described above from the any place of the job.
